For passionate golfers seeking stunning greens, warm hospitality, and a touch of Ghanaian culture.
Itinerary:
Day 1: Arrival & Tee-Off in Accra
Morning: Arrival at Kotoka International Airport – VIP pickup and hotel check-in (5-star hotel or golf resort like Accra Marriott or Labadi Beach Hotel)
Welcome drink & light breakfast at the hotel
Afternoon: Tee Time at Achimota Golf Club
Historic 18-hole course set amidst lush vegetation
Golf gear rental available (or bring your own)
Light coaching session or solo play
Refreshments at the clubhouse
Evening: Sunset dinner at Skybar25 with views over Accra
Optional: Night stroll at Oxford Street, Osu
Day 2: Golf & Culture Combo
Morning: Early golf session at Celebrity Golf Club, Sakumono
Scenic 9-hole course by the coast
Great for relaxed competitive play or practicing short game
Afternoon: Cultural Experience:
Visit W.E.B. DuBois Centre and Independence Arch
Lunch at Santoku or Buka (modern Ghanaian cuisine)
Evening: Return to hotel for spa or massage session (optional recovery treat)
Private cocktail or wine tasting event at the hotel
Day 3: Championship Golf & Departure
Morning: Drive to Safari Valley Resort (1.5 – 2 hours from Accra)
Premium eco-resort with a world-class golf facility under development (or alternative visit to Tema Country Golf Club)
Play a relaxed 9 or 18-hole round depending on your timing
Optional: nature walk or short quad biking tour after play
Afternoon: Lunch at the resort or return to Accra for final meal
Souvenir stop (local golf apparel or kente gifts)
Evening: Airport drop-off and departure from Kotoka International Airport
Day 4: Cultural & Natural Highlights Near Accra
Morning: Visit the Aburi Botanical Gardens, located about an hour from Accra, to enjoy lush tropical flora and scenic views.
Explore the Aburi Craft Market, known for handcrafted souvenirs, wood carvings, and traditional Ghanaian art.
Afternoon: Take a short drive to the Shai Hills Resource Reserve for a nature walk and wildlife viewing (antelopes, monkeys, bird species).
Learn about conservation efforts and enjoy panoramic views from the hills.
Evening: Return to Accra for dinner at a local restaurant offering Ghanaian delicacies, such as Boti or Fufu with light music or live drumming performance.
Day 5: History & Art Tour
Morning: Visit the National Museum of Ghana to explore Ghanaian history, artifacts, and cultural exhibits.
Head to Artists Alliance Gallery in Labone for contemporary Ghanaian art, paintings, and crafts—perfect for souvenir shopping.
Afternoon: Explore the Artists Village at Jamestown, a historic fishing neighborhood known for its colonial architecture, street art, and vibrant community.
Optional: Visit the Korle Bu Teaching Hospital or Ussher Fort for insights into Ghana's colonial history and resilience.
Evening: Relax at your hotel or enjoy a sunset cruise on the Gulf of Guinea (if available), offering a serene view of the coast.
Day 6: Leisure & Local Experiences
Morning: Visit Labadi Beach for relaxation, beach sports, or a horseback ride along the shore.
Optional: Participate in a traditional Ghanaian cooking class to learn local recipes.
Afternoon: Take a Ghanaian textiles and kente weaving workshop at a local craft center—immerse yourself in Ghanaian craftsmanship.
Visit the Makola Market for an authentic shopping experience, sampling local foods and buying souvenirs.
Evening: Enjoy a farewell dinner at a top restaurant with live Ghanaian music, such as Skybar25 or Coco Lounge.
Prepare for departure the next day.
